The Significance of City Bushes in Quebec


City trees play vital roles in enhancing the aesthetic appeal of cities whereas providing numerous ecological advantages. They take in carbon dioxide, produce oxygen, scale back air pollution, and mitigate the urban heat island impact – a phenomenon the place urban areas are considerably hotter than their surrounding rural areas. Furthermore, bushes provide essential habitats for wildlife and contribute to the general well-being of metropolis dwellers by selling psychological health and decreasing stress levels (1).


Challenges in Urban Tree Care


Regardless Of the numerous benefits that city timber provide, they face numerous challenges in Quebec cities. These embrace:


Urban Development: Speedy urbanization often results in tree loss as a end result of construction tasks, street widening, and infrastructure improvement.
Pollution: Air and soil air pollution can compromise tree health, making them more susceptible to ailments and pests.
Invasive Species: The introduction of invasive plant species can outcompete native timber for assets, leading to declining populations of useful tree species.
Climate Change: Changing climate patterns, such as elevated droughts and extreme temperatures, put stress on city bushes and compromise their capacity to thrive.


Methods for Sustainable Urban Tree Care in Quebec


To tackle these challenges, several strategies have been proposed:


Planting the Right Trees: Choosing tree species that are well-adapted to local climate situations and resilient to urban stressors can improve their possibilities of success.
Pruning and Maintenance: Common pruning helps preserve tree construction, promotes progress, and prevents potential hazards attributable to useless branches.
Safety Measures: Implementing protective measures corresponding to fencing, limitations, and root protection zones may help safeguard city trees during construction initiatives.
Public Education: Educating metropolis dwellers concerning the importance of city trees and best practices for Tree Keepers care can foster a more tree-friendly community.
Urban Forest Management Plans: Creating complete city forest management plans that handle tree planting, upkeep, and elimination strategies may help ensure long-term sustainability of city forests in Quebec cities.
